Output 3504bddd52d07bcf205f6978f167779dab8dc915acc358b28f26204b6df91d54:2

value
25145325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e923c52a94b07810f7917ab29550dc76e0db6f4a OP_EQUAL
address
MV9tXUw7uKbF7Ju5dzP5LvVhonSfEicA75
transaction
3504bddd52d07bcf205f6978f167779dab8dc915acc358b28f26204b6df91d54
spent
true